Completely different subject, a very late one to be discussing (by one day), but I finally read over your post in detail, Blackwolf, and it bothered me how you set up Aoi to immediately be a novice and a bad shot, going so far as stating;Normally, decisions about the character's skills and what he is doing should fall into the writer of the character's hands, not another player. I didn't say in any of my former post that he was a bad shooter, in fact, I made him state the opposite. Thus, this would fall into the category of being a strain of power-playing, which is usually frowned upon.I'm not trying to be a jerk, just stating my own opinion and preferences and if you could do something about this, I would be extremely appreciative of it.


Rafale is completely right - I have mentioned this in the rules to the game in the first post.
If it's your characters opinion that someone looks like they don't know what they're doing, then that's fine. But if the player has stated in their post that they do know what they're doing and are in fact good at their job/task/whatever, then that's kind of putting words into their mouths - metaphorically speaking - or taking control to some degree of someone elses' character, and that's something that's not really okay.
